Tuition Fees and Expenses for Academic Year 2020-2021

 

 

Although Shiraz is one of the largest cities in Iran, cost of living here is almost affordable. This makes Shiraz a perfect destination for students. However, as an international student, you need to verify that you have the funds for your tuition and living costs during your stay as a student. You might either introduce a sponsor who will pay for your expenses or you will afford the costs yourself.

Note 1: Shiraz University of Medical Sciences will award a variety of scholarships which may lead to the full waiving of the expenses. All international students are eligible to apply for these scholarships. To see complete information regarding SUMS scholarships please click here.

 

Note 2:  In addition to the living expenses pointed out in the above table (table of expenses) students should be aware that other life expenses (including items of clothing, books, stationaries, food, dining out, etc.) for single students is approximately between 200.00 to 300.00 U.S.D. per month. None of SUMS scholarships cover such expenses.

SUMS is committed to supporting students in any manner possible including the financial matters. We allocate scholarships to students. Any student has the opportunity to apply for a scholarship. You should prove your aptness for receiving a scholarship during your application process. The most qualified applicants will have a higher chance of winning a scholarship.

 

Applicants should be aware that withdrawing from studies at any point of the studies at SUMS, can cost them the whole annual tuition fee as well as relevant fines (such as accommodation, utilities, internet, health insurance, and registration fees) according to the University regulations.
